About
Uncle Lucius is a Texas-based musical group known for their captivating blend of roots rock, outlaw country, Red Dirt, modern southern rock, and classic Texas country. Formed in Austin, the band originally consisted of Kevin Galloway (vocals, guitar), Mike Carpenter (guitar), Josh Greco (drums), Nigel Frye (bass), and Jon Grossman (keyboards). Over the years, Uncle Lucius has built a reputation for their dynamic live performances and authentic sound, drawing influences from the rich musical landscape of Texas.
How to Sound Like Uncle Lucius
Uncle Lucius's sound is characterized by warm, gritty guitar tones and soulful, resonant vocals. Their music often features bluesy, overdriven guitar riffs that are likely shaped through tube amps and analog overdrive pedals, giving their songs a raw and organic edge. The rhythm section provides a solid, yet laid-back groove, with dynamic drumming and melodic bass lines that anchor their southern rock influences. The keyboards add depth and texture, often utilizing vintage-style organ and piano sounds to complement the band's rich sonic palette. To capture the essence of Uncle Lucius, musicians should focus on achieving a balanced mix of earthy tones and heartfelt lyricism, emphasizing authenticity and emotional resonance in their performances.
